Skip to main content
Close Search
Menu
About
Work
News
Contact
Category
Uncategorised
Uncategorised
Childs Farm goes Live!
Uncategorised
Derek Griffiths’ premiere in Sarah & Duck!
Uncategorised
Oh Say Can You Karrot?
Uncategorised
Sarah & Duck Merchandise Now Available!
Uncategorised
Prix Jeunesse 2014!
Uncategorised
Karrot’s latest Moshi music video goes live!
Uncategorised
World Book Day!
Uncategorised
Kidscreen Awards 2014!
Uncategorised
Karrot promotes the evolution of the Ford Mustang!
Uncategorised
Cartoon Network Winter Idents hit the airwaves!
Previous
1
2
3
4
…
6
Next
Close Menu
About
Work
News
Contact
Karrot
The Studio,
11 Morecambe Street,
London,
SE17 1DX
+44 (0) 207 703 2080
9.30am-6pm Mon-Fri
Karrot, The Studio, 11 Morecambe St, London, SE17 1DX, +44(0)207 703 2080
Sign-up for all the news, fresh from the Karrot patch!